NOIP歷年題目分析

2021-08-09 17:33:48 字數 1077 閱讀 3766

em……主要是對近幾年來noip的考試真題的考點分析。

鑑於noip一直以來沒有固定的考察範圍,複習的時候一般是按照約定俗成的範圍學習,然而ccf就是不按常理出牌(2023年因為兩個dp吃鍵盤的人有多少??),出題難以捉摸。但是總體來說,過於困難的問題考察到的機率還是非常小的。

模擬 noip 2016 day 1 t1

noip 2015 day 1 t1

noip 2014 day 1 t1

noip 2013 day 2 t1

暴力搜尋+剪枝

noip 2015 day 1 t3

noip 2014 day 2 t1

noip 2013 day 2 t3

貪心 noip 2013 day 1 t2

noip 2013 day 2 t2 (+資料結構)

二分 noip 2015 day 2 t1

noip 2015 day 2 t3

數論 noip 2016 day 2 t1 (組合數取模)

noip 2014 day 2 t3 (模數)

noip 2013 day 1 t1 (快速冪)

動態規劃

noip 2016 day 1 t3 (期望dp + 弗洛伊德)

noip 2016 day 2 t3 (狀壓dp)

noip 2015 day 2 t2 (字串dp)

noip 2014 day 1 t2 (樹形dp)

noip 2014 day 1 t3 (完全揹包dp)

圖論/樹

noip 2016 day 1 t2 (樹鏈剖分 + lca + 樹上差分)

noip 2015 day 1 t2 (tarjan)

noip 2015 day 2 t3 (樹上差分)

noip 2014 day 2 t2 (雙向bfs)

noip 2013 day 1 t3 (最小生成樹 + lca)

總得來說暴力分還是非常的多……很多題的正解尤其可怕……

2023年的day1t3…2023年的day2t3……2023年的day1t3……2023年的day1t2

NOIP歷年好題

noip2015 運輸計畫 如果實在不懂 二分答案,鏈長 lca 樹上差分 為什麼想到樹上差分?因為他就只有兩種用途 1.找被所有路徑共同覆蓋的邊。2.將路徑上的所有點權值加一,求最後點的權值 那麼怎麼具體的來樹上差分呢?嗯嗯,順帶複習一下dfs序呢 noip2012疫情控制 可以練碼力 用到的演算...

歷年noip複賽試題整合

早晨打算把歷年的試題都過一遍,整理一下大概會往哪個方向考,考什麼,不說太多,開始吧 2013 day1 t1 轉圈遊戲 快速冪 關鍵在於要會打 快速冪 思路 因為每次都進m位,相當於每次x加上m,即x總共前進了m 10 k 答案就是 x m 10 k mod n t2 火柴排隊 離散 轉化成求逆序對...

NOIP2015題目簡單分析

今年的noip的前兩題比較簡單,原題是在noi題庫上的題目,分別是金幣和掃雷遊戲兩道題都是相當簡單。下面簡單分析一下這次考的題目。金幣 這一道題沒有什麼好說的,做的方法五花八門,比較簡單,我就直接用兩個變數j和sum,還有乙個每次加1的i,令得i 1,j 0,接著j每次都加乙個i,sum每次都加乙個...